Instapay vs Pesonet (What You Need To Know)

Both PESOnet and InstaPay are electronic payment services that can be used for Fund transfers, Payments for goods and services, including periodic payments, as well as payments to the government.

PESOnet and InstaPay Features

InstaPayPESOnet
Funds available to recipient almost immediatelyFunds available on the same day (Subject to Transaction Cut-off time)
Transfer up to P50,000 per transactionTransfer any amount per transaction (banks/EMIs set limit)
Alternative to cash (banknotes and coins)Alternative to cheques
Available 24/7 all year roundProcessing of transactions during banking days only and subject to cut-off times
Immediate and urgent transactionsPlanned and non-urgent transactions

How to use InstaPay and PESOnet?

  • Check if the payment service provider is a PESONet or InstaPay participating bank or E-money issuer (EMI).
  • Open the mobile or online banking app and choose the TRANSFER FUNDS option Select “Via PESONet or via InstaPay.
  • Enter the amount and recipient’s account details.
  • Approve transaction (A confirmation email or SMS message will be sent to you for your fund’s transfer).

WHAT TO DO IN CASE OF TRANSACTION ISSUES

REPORT TO THE BANK OR E-MONEY ISSUER

• Take note of your transaction confirmation email/SMS or funds transfer transaction number. A copy or screenshot of the transaction receipt will also be useful and can be presented to banks/EMIs in case of transaction issues.

Call/engage the sending and receiving entities through their website, phone banking facility, or mobile app for consumer complaints.

• Be familiar with the processing times of banks and/or EMIS.
